Output 4cf61539ae60ebc67b1b8ffa9f21dc36ffd7631faafbfaacbd8523fc1ef7e794:100

value
171000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012e504fe6981413b7f2e8f5a402c2a4cd00d8f1 OP_EQUAL
address
31oG5fmU6byupxsMgmXfbxvmrk8BpBZCmU
transaction
4cf61539ae60ebc67b1b8ffa9f21dc36ffd7631faafbfaacbd8523fc1ef7e794
confirmations
266725
spent
true